第2部分:Python 面向对象
1、类与对象1.1 定义类 通常你需要在单独的文件中定义一个类 [root@hadron python]# vi Employee.py #!/usr/bin/python
# -*- coding: UTF-8 -*-
#定义类
class Employee:
'所有员工的基类'
转载
2024-01-09 21:21:06
93阅读
# 使用 Python 实现 VECM (向量误差修正模型)
欢迎来到统计与机器学习的世界!如果你想了解如何在 Python 中实现 VECM 模型,我们将通过一个简单的流程来完成这项任务。VECM 是一种用于分析时间序列数据模型的工具,它能帮助我们处理非平稳数据的协整关系。
## 实现 VECM 的流程
以下是你需要遵循的步骤:
| 步骤 | 描述
MIC:将声信号转换为电信号的器件。 目前市场上的MIC主要分为ECM与MEMS两大类型。 然而,我们今天主要讲的是ECM,即驻极体电容式麦克风。在手机应用中,其主要应用于耳机MIC电路中。其余的主副MIC则为MEMS类型。 ECM类型的MIC内部可以简单的理解为一个膜片电容与一个FET构成。当有声音传输时,会带动薄膜振动,进而使得空气间隙发生变化。改变电容量与电磁场,产生电信号,E=Q/C。 F
转载
2024-04-11 12:48:04
344阅读
# 如何实现 Python 中的 ECM 模型
在经济学和计量经济学中,ECM(误差修正模型)是一种流行的时间序列模型,用于分析变量之间的长期和短期动态关系。本文将指导你如何用Python实现ECM模型,涵盖从数据准备到模型建立的完整流程。
## 流程步骤
以下是实现ECM模型的整体流程:
| 步骤 | 描述
原创
2024-09-22 06:18:05
254阅读
卷积交叉分量模型(convolutional cross-component model,CCCM)基本思想和CCLM模式类似,建立亮度和色度之间模型实现从亮度重建像素预测色度像素。和CCLM一样,预测色度像素前,需要对亮度重建块进行下采样,以匹配色度块尺寸。 此外,与 CCLM 类似,可以选择使用 CCCM 的单模型或多模型变体。 多模型变体使用两个模型,一个模型用于高于平均亮度参考值的样本,另
转载
2023-11-27 10:18:03
20阅读
给你一个大数n,将它分解它的质因子的乘积的形式。首先需要了解Miller_rabin判断一个数是否是素数大数分解最简单的思想也是试除法,这里就不再展示代码了,就是从2到sqrt(n),一个一个的试验,直到除到1或者循环完,最后判断一下是否已经除到1了即可。 但是这样的做的复杂度是相当高的。一种很妙的思路是找到一个因子(不一定是质因子),然后再一路分解下去。这就是基于Miller_rabi
转载
2024-07-15 13:24:43
87阅读
本系列:第1节:估计模型参数在这一节,我们将讨论贝叶斯方法是如何思考数据的,我们怎样通过 MCMC 技术估计模型参数。from IPython.display import Image
import matplotlib.pyplot as plt
import numpy as np
import pandas as pd
import pymc3 as pm
import scipy
impo
eval(str)函数很强大,官方解释为:将字符串str当成有效的表达式来求值并返回计算结果。所以,结合math当成一个计算器很好用。eval()函数常见作用有: 1、计算字符串中有效的表达式,并返回结果>>> eval('pow(2,2)') 4 >>> eval('2 + 2') 4 >>> eval("n + 4") 85
>&g
关于麦克风的参数介绍 - 驻极体麦克风(ECM)和硅麦(MEMS)1、麦克风的分类1.1、动圈式麦克风(Dynamic Micphone) 原理:基本构造包含线圈、振膜、永久磁铁三部分。当声波进入麦克风,振膜受到声波的压力而产生振动,与振膜在一起的线圈则开始在磁场中移动,根据法拉第的楞次定律,线圈会产生感应电流。 特性:动圈式麦克风因含有磁铁和线圈,不够轻便、灵敏度较低、高低频响应表现较差;优点是
转载
2024-05-25 22:30:59
1249阅读
EMI(Electro Magnetic Interference)直译是电磁干扰。这是合成词,我们应该分别考虑"电磁"和"干扰"。所谓"干扰",指设备受到干扰后性能降低以及对设备产生干扰的干扰源这二层意思。第一层意思如雷电使收音机产生杂音,摩托车在附近行驶后电视画面出现雪花,拿起电话后听到无线电声音等,这些可以简称其为与"BC I""TV I""Tel I",这些缩写中
其实很早就想写这篇文章了,虽然晚上介绍vim的文章很多,本博也已经就vim的使用写了70多篇博文,但是由于历史的原因,还有很多人对vim能做什么存在误解,包括: vim对中文支持不好 vim适合临时编辑文本,对IDE的支持不好 vim的内嵌脚本语言不够强大,不像emacs的lisp那样无所不能 我不知道提出这些论断的人是因为不了不了解vim的现状,还是是对vim心存偏见。本博在写vim相关文章的
# R语言的VECM检验
## 简介
VECM(Vector Error Correction Model)是一种多变量时间序列建模方法,用于分析变量之间的长期和短期关系。在R语言中,可以通过`vars`包来实现VECM检验。本文将介绍VECM检验的流程,并提供相应的R代码示例。
## 流程
下面是实施VECM检验的一般步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 1.
原创
2023-07-19 14:26:41
701阅读
python 命令行创建虚拟环境cmd 打开命令提示符 找到自己想创建的位置路径 输入python -m venv 创建的名称例如:Microsoft Windows [版本 10.0.19042.685]
(c) 2020 Microsoft Corporation. 保留所有权利。
C:\Windows\system32>d:
D:\>cd D:\Software
D:\So
转载
2023-06-05 21:10:13
128阅读
选择内容管理平台还是解决方案? 随着企业内容管理(ECM)技术和市场环境的不断地发展,越来越多的企业开始考虑选择适当的产品。美国Interwoven公司通过长期的实践,总结出企业在选择ECM系统时应该关注以下几点:是否具有良好的操作性及弹性?对于企业使用者来说是否容易使用?是否能同其他应用系统无缝整合?是否能够便利的提供企业所需要的工具,而无须其它客户化开发、培训及支持? 目前在ECM市场上有两
电磁兼容相关理解一、电磁兼容——EMC的意义及分类二、基础理论1、时域和频域描述2、CE测试单位3、RE测试单位 一、电磁兼容——EMC的意义及分类 EMC(Electro Magetic Compatibility,电磁兼容)是指电子、电气设备或系统在预期的电磁环境中,按设计要求正常工作的能力。既然称为能力,必然有它具体的体现,就是指在电路实际工作中的表现。 包括以下两方面含义: 1、E
基于估计的无约束预测控制 1.引言 基本上这两个部分都是在线性理论的框架下,利用状态空间法来建模、求解控制律。状态空间模型在理论分析上具有很强的优越性,但实际应用中能直接准确且经济地获取系统状态并不容易。有些状态,尤其是温度(如火箭喷口温度等)只能间接估计,因此我们可以使用状态观测器来重构一个易于实现的系统来模拟原系统的状态。  
转载
2024-09-06 19:30:03
0阅读
# R语言实现VAR模型向量误差修正模型(VECM)
作为一名经验丰富的开发者,我将指导你如何使用R语言实现VAR模型的向量误差修正模型(VECM)。首先,让我们了解VECM的基本概念:它是一种多变量时间序列模型,用于分析变量之间的动态关系,并允许短期和长期关系同时存在。
## 流程图
以下是实现VECM的步骤流程:
```mermaid
flowchart TD
A[开始] --
原创
2024-07-26 10:06:08
48阅读
# VECM模型在R语言中的应用
向量误差修正模型(VECM)是一种用于多变量时间序列分析的强大工具,尤其适用于非平稳数据的协整分析。VECM能够有效捕捉不同变量之间的长期关系,并通过短期波动进行调整,因而在经济学、金融学等多个领域得到广泛应用。
## 1. VECM模型简介
VECM模型主要用于分析多个相关时间序列变量的动态关系。在建立VECM模型之前,首先需要检测变量的平稳性和协整关系。
传统上,协整的测试是在非常长的时间内进行的,本案例研究A测试了1960-2010年期间T-Bill利率和国债收益率之间的平衡。但是作为量化主义者,我们必须在市场数据中寻找共同运动。现货曲线银行提供每日收益率曲线数据。考虑长时间框架的小窗口是有意义的。2013年5月至2015年5月的两年窗口期(以下图表)。• 所有数据从2005年1月至2015年5月。 我们必须学习均衡修正模型ECM(误差
原创
2022-11-10 10:37:59
261阅读
• 这种不同期限的即期利率的演变情况是一种基础关系的情况。• 因此,
原创
2022-10-23 10:10:19
10000+阅读